Shutter Materials & Style
Our window shutters have a range of materials to fit any household or commercial needs, all of our different styles can be done with the following materials as well as various finishes and colours
Paulownia Wood
Knot-free grain, 13 paints, 11 stains, Limewash option. Lightweight, eco-friendly, Clearview rod, various styles.
Ashwood
Deep wood grain, premium Ash Hardwood, stained or painted. Emphasizes natural grain variation.
Waterproof
100% waterproof, durable aluminum core, withstands moisture, neutral white paints, stainless steel hardware.
Faux Wood
Handcrafted, 2-week lead time, 3 slat sizes, 2 white paints, moisture-resistant PVC composite, various designs.
Full Height Style Shutters

Our top seller shutter provides full-height coverage for doors and windows. Divider rail offers separate control. Choose thinner bifolding panels for daily use, balancing privacy and openness.
Solid Style Shutters

Our Paulownia Hardwood Solid Shutters draw inspiration from the Victorian era, with options for Solid Raised or Solid Shaker inserts. These provide maximum darkness but open fully daily. A Combination Style offers a solid bottom with customizable top slats and a divider rail for definition.
Café Style Shutters

Café Style shutters cover the lower window section, letting in maximum light. In bedrooms or lounges, add a top covering for privacy and darkness.
Tier-on-Tier Style Shutters
Double hung shutters are versatile and ideal for tall windows. Upper panels open separately, maximizing light and privacy. Consider thinner bifolding panels for neat folding. Great for Victorian and Georgian properties.

Doors & Tracks

We offer diverse installation options for different door sizes. Divider rails add strength to taller shutters. French doors and adjoining windows can use multiple frames. Consider tracked shutters for unobstructed views, suitable for both doors and room dividers. They offer smooth, effortless operation.
